>The radios sometimes receive transmissions from an apparently failed Russian space program over a century ago despite modern vessels using FTL communication systems that shouldn't pick up such signals

>False readings from engineering suggesting imminent critical failures in major systems.

>The airlocks occasionally go into "open" cycles complete with a positive life sign reading within them though no one can actually be seen inside or leaving them once they open into the ship.

>working long hours will cause hallucinations like occasionally thinking you found evidence the medical wing have been conducting experiments on passengers in cryo sleep.

>sometimes the lights flicker down long hallways and you think you see a lumbering figure in a space suit pass through the shadows.

The ship was used by smugglers before you brought it. As a result, there are many hidden passages in your ship. Sometimes you can hear noises from those passages, but no lifesigns are beeing read. You'd write it off as some kind of machinery echoing around, but those noises also happen when everything is turned off.

>Sometimes when you walk over grating, you keep hearing footsteps behind you, they persist for some time after you stop

>it never happens during any crucial moments, but sometimes all the lights just go dead in the ship and stay off for several minutes. Ship diagnostics never say anything is wrong

>despite the best efforts of the cleaning and medical staff, there's always dried blood on a few beds. Sensors detect nothing suspicious about it but it happens even when new beds are bought.

>Occasionally, you'll hear an AI voice speak over the ship's PA. The ship either doesn't need and lacks an AI, or it is not the one already installed.
